How Much Does a Membership Analyst Make in Minnesota?

Updated April 01, 2025
As of April 01, 2025, the average annual pay of Membership Analyst in Minnesota is $46,679. While Salary.com is seeing that Membership Analyst salary in MN can go up to $62,748 or down to $33,888, but most earn between $39,984 and $55,090.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, and your experience levels. Top 10 Highest Paying Cities For Membership Analyst Jobs in Minnesota

It is important to understand how location impacts your career prospects in the United States. There are some cities where a Membership Analyst can find a job easily with a greater salary paid then achieve a higher standard of living. Below is the top cities list for Membership Analyst job salaries in Minnesota. Some cities can pay higher salaries for Membership Analyst jobs, which can indicate that there is a large demand for Membership Analyst positions in this city.
The following table shows top 10 cities where the Membership Analyst salary is higher than other cities in Minnesota. Minneapolis takes first place in this list, followed by Saint Paul, Minnetonka. The Membership Analyst salary is $47,742 in Minneapolis, which is higher than the national average. There are 7 cities' Membership Analyst salary higher than national average in Minnesota.
The average salary for a Membership Analyst in Minnesota is $46,679, but we found that the city with the highest salary for Membership Analyst jobs is Minneapolis, MN, and it is higher than Saint Paul. Membership Analyst jobs in Minneapolis can have the opportunity to earn higher salaries than in other cities in Minnesota.
CITY ANNUAL SALARY MONTHLY PAY WEEKLY PAY HOURLY WAGE
Minneapolis $47,742 $3,979 $918 $23
Saint Paul $47,742 $3,979 $918 $23
Minnetonka $47,742 $3,979 $918 $23
Eden Prairie $47,660 $3,972 $917 $23
Burnsville $47,605 $3,967 $915 $23
Lakeville $47,441 $3,953 $912 $23
Rochester $45,731 $3,811 $879 $22
Saint Cloud $45,001 $3,750 $865 $22
Duluth $43,755 $3,646 $841 $21
